Limited options: Male contraception is limited to condoms, withdrawal (or pulling out), abstinence and vasectomy. Condoms and the withdrawal method are convenient but have a high failure rate. Vasectomy is very effective but isn't reversible if you want children in the future. There are no male contraceptive pills. Best wishes!
